TLDR : Answer Summary
Many expats are experiencing delays and issues with their bank accounts being frozen at the Bangkok Bank Central Pattaya branch. Customers are advised to follow up closely with the bank, as several have had similar experiences waiting beyond the initial promised timeframe for account release. Some expats have been able to successfully release their accounts after providing additional documentation or contacting bank officials, while others have found themselves waiting for several weeks. Alternative banking solutions, such as opening accounts with other banks like Kasikorn, are suggested by some to avoid the hassle.

Phil *********
@Ishbel **********
hi it was Bangkok bank that wanted all pages copied I just could not be bothered with all they wanted to see again as had done this 2 months earlier, so we're they going to freeze my account again in 2 months ,, I went kasikorn to open account, passport, rental agreement, residence certificate from immigration, had new account in 1 hour, and transfers take seconds so more than happy

Jay ******
Mine was finally released after the 22nd working day… they eventually wanted a one year lease instead of a six month lease, even though mine was a renewal from a one year lease… when I finally gave them that yesterday they released my account in one hour at the original bank that I started it at…
